Facts

Nelson assigned the proceeds of a contract to Salem (P) in May 1919 and also assigned the same proceeds to Manufacturer's (D) in July 1919. D notified the debtor of the assignment. In September, a receiver was appointed over Nelson, and each assignee learned of the other. Both assignees agreed to allow Nelson to finish the work to be performed and the proceeds were to be placed in trust until the priorities among them had been determined.
